What Bulb customers should do after energy firm enters special administration affecting 1.7m people

Energy supplier Bulb has been placed into special administration, the company has announced. The green energy firm has assured its 1.7 million customers that there will be no disruption to their energy supplies following the move.

Bulb is the UK's seventh biggest energy supplier after the 'Big Six' companies. In a statement on its website, Bulb said: "We’ve made the difficult decision to support Bulb being placed into special administration.

This process is designed to protect Bulb members, ensuring there’s no change to your supply and your credit balance is protected." The company becomes the latest in a string of firms affected by the global energy crisis, which has seen gas prices soar.
